Erectile Dysfunction
Erectile Dysfunction (ED), also known as impotence, is the inability to achieve or maintain an erection during sexual activity. It can have a significant impact on a man’s self-esteem, mental health, and intimate relationships. While many factors can contribute to ED, it’s essential to approach the issue with empathy and a focus on finding a solution. Here are some key considerations to keep in mind when discussing ED and seeking help for your partner:
Factors Contributing to ED
Age: ED is more common as men age, but it is not an inevitable part of aging.
Medical Conditions: Conditions such as diabetes, heart disease, and high blood pressure can contribute to ED.
Lifestyle Factors: Smoking, excessive alcohol consumption, and a sedentary lifestyle can increase the risk of ED.
Psychological Factors: Stress, anxiety, depression, and relationship issues can contribute to ED.
Medication Side Effects: Certain medications may cause or worsen ED as a side effect.

Nurturing Open Communication
Approach with Compassion: When initiating a conversation about ED, approach the topic with empathy and understanding, emphasizing that you are there to support and seek solutions together.
Empower Through Education: Share the information you’ve learned about ED and reassure your partner that seeking help is a positive step toward reclaiming intimacy.
Encourage Seeking Professional Help: Express your willingness to explore treatment options together and accompany your partner to appointments to provide support.
Maintain Positivity: Encourage positivity and emphasize that seeking help for ED is a proactive step toward enhancing intimacy and overall well-being.
